Performance Note

All fog machines develop condensation around the output nozzle. Because this may

result in some moisture accumulation on the surface below the output nozzle, consider

this condensation when installing your unit.

All fog machines may sputter small amounts of fog occasionally during operation and for

a minute or so after being turned off.

Maintenance

Do not allow the fog liquid to become contaminated. Always replace the caps on the fog

liquid container and the fog machine liquid tank immediately after filling. After every 40 hours

of operation, it is recommended to use distilled water to run a cleaning process.

The recommended cleaning regimen is as follows:

4. Empty all fog liquid from the machine. Add distilled water to liquid tank. Plug unit in and

begin warm up.

5. Run the unit in a well-ventilated area and run the fog machine briefly. Do not allow the

pump to run dry.

6. Cleaning is now completed. Empty the water left inside liquid tank and refill with fog liquid.

Run the machine briefly again.
